Jose Blanco is set to join E.P. Carrillo as its new Senior Vice President of Sales effective November 1st 2016. First news of this story was reported by Cigar Aficionado, and confirmed to Cigar Coop through Blanco’s wife Emma Viktorsson. It didn’t take long for members of Congress to react to United States President Barack Obama’s recent easing of trade restrictions with Cuba. This past Friday, Senator James Lankford (R-Oklahoma) and Representative Mario Diaz-Balart wrote a letter to President expressing concerns with the actions as well as requesting more engagement with Congress over the matter. After five months of speculation,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ration has confirmed its regulations which prohibit cigar companies from distributing samples also appliy to donating free cigars to soldiers. British American Tobacco has announced a proposal to merge with Reynolds American Inc. The merger would create the world’s largest tobacco company. While short-term, this has greater impacts on the cigarette industry, this could create be something the premium cigar industry keeps an eye on.
